124pp, with a handful of in-text picture. Green cloth-covered boards, gilt titles on front. Rubbed spine ends. Previous owner’s name on front free end paper. Browned free end papers. Otherwise internally neat, clean, bright and tight. 8vo. History of the growth of Harrogate and its surrounding villages with section on Bilton-in-Harrogate, Harrogate in Wartime, Pre-Victorian Travel, Life in the Harrogate Workhouse, The first Church, Local Schools, etc.
